## Service account: plugin-relay

Plugin authors integrating with the Tessellate websocket gateway should note a known reconnect bug: after a dropped connection, the gateway may accept your handshake but silently discard the first two frames. Until the fix ships, send a no-op ping before any real traffic. Your plugin must authenticate through the shared `plugin-relay` service account; do not mint your own credentials. The account's key for the internal relay endpoint follows.

service key, fawip-bajef: kto11_Qt5wZK9vdNC

Subject: DR drill next Thursday — heads up

Hi new folks! We're running a disaster-recovery drill on the Payflux payments service. Fair warning: the integration tests are flaky right now (the settlement mock times out randomly), so don't panic if the first run goes red. Just rerun before escalating. To restore the vault during the drill, you'll need the recovery passphrase below.

unlock words, kawig-bawef: belax-sorir-druax-ulaiel-wenael-belael

Facilities Ticket — Cleaning Crew Access, Brindle Annex

For new starters handling evening lock-up: the Sorano Cleaning crew arrives nightly at 21:30 via the annex side door. Check their rota sheet, note arrival in the log, and ensure the storeroom is relocked afterward. To let them through the side door, enter the access code below.

badge for yaweg-hafog: bdg-GX-6

Management Meeting Minutes — Hollowpine Instruments

Attendees: J. Marsk, T. Obell, R. Finner. Main topic was the warranty overrun on the Cindervale pump series — we're about 28% over budget, mostly from seal failures in units shipped out of the Brackton plant. Tessa's team has a fix in testing and expects claims to taper by spring. We agreed to hold pricing steady for now and revisit in six weeks. The confidential note on how this affects our plans is below.

confidential, kagep-kahof: Druokax Systems plans to lower the Ulaath list price by 53 percent in March.